An original woven paste back example in very good condition.Authorised A/17 of 1943, introduced a badge of a launch at speed with the letters ASR emboided in the design. Worn on the right sleeve of the service dress jacket , or the heavy duty blouse, or the khaki drill frock. NCOs and LACs wore it above the chevrons or propeller badge. It was not worn on greatcoats. The badge was abolished in June 1948. Printed examples and those in red for tropical service dress are also encountered.Tanner p 261 refers.Comm DaSm
